# Env file — Cartwheel dispatch, driver-assignment heuristic
# Scope: staging only. Do not promote to prod.
# The heuristic weights (proximity, shift balance, refusal rate) are tuned
# for the Velmont pilot region and will misbehave elsewhere.
# Review notes: heuristic service runs unprivileged; it reads weights
# read-only from the tuning store and writes nothing back.
# Only one sensitive value exists in this file: the tuning-store access
# credential, consumed at boot and never logged.
# That credential is set on the following line.

secret setting of faduf-bahop: LEDGER_TOKEN8=c3b363be

## Onboarding: Farebranch Rules Engine

Plugin authors integrate with Farebranch by registering fee rules against the evaluation API. Rules are sandboxed; they cannot perform network calls directly. All rate-table lookups go through the host, which validates your plugin manifest at load time. Your local env file must include the signing credential the host uses to verify manifests, set on the next line.

secret setting of bajef-fajof: COURIER_KEY3=76c

Contacts — Sensor Drift (VerdantLoop Controller)

For security review questions about sensor drift handling in the VerdantLoop greenhouse controller, the calibration team owns drift thresholds and alert suppression logic. Firmware signing and telemetry integrity fall under the embedded security group. Drift anomalies suspected to be tampering rather than hardware aging should be reported to the calibration team lead first.

alerts address for fahip-kajep: istox.fraox@qorvellabs.internal

## Notification Fan-Out Backpressure

The Pipwire fan-out tier sheds load when downstream delivery lags. Watch `fanout_queue_lag` on the Harrowfield dash. If lag exceeds 30s, the shaper throttles low-priority topics automatically. Do not raise worker counts past 64; it starves the dedup cache. Manual drain: `pipwire drain --tier=low`. Escalate only if critical topics lag. Drain commands hit the internal Valvekeeper API and require the service key below.

API key for tagef-fafop: vxb2-ta